Project Title

SR 408 Mainline Plaza Sign Updates

Physical Address View project details and contacts
City, State (County) Orlando, FL 32803   (Orange County)
Category(s) Single Trades
Sub-Category(s) Electric
Contracting Method Competitive Bids
Project Status Sub-Bidding, Construction start expected August 2023
Bids Due View project details and contacts
Estimated Value $550,000 [brand] Estimate
Plans Available from State Agency
Owner View project details and contacts
Architect View project details and contacts
Description

The work consists of providing all labor, materials, equipment, and incidentals for the replacement of sign panels on existing changeable message signs (CMS), addition of new signs and auxiliary panels, removal of sign panels and CMS sign assemblies, and relocation of CMS sign assemblies along SR 408. Work also includes the removal of toll plaza pavement messages/ markings. The Contract time for this project will be 120 calendar days. Click here to join the meeting Meeting ID: 278 515 322 181 Passcode: yLrwVs Download Teams | Join on the web Or call in (audio only) +1 321-235-6136,132575727# United States, Orlando Phone Conference ID: 132 575 727# At the time of Bid submittal, Bidder as the "prime" contractor must be prequalified by the Florida Department of Transportation under Administrative Rule 14-22, Florida Administrative Code, in: Roadway Signing. A copy of the Bidder's current prequalification certificate shall be submitted with the Bid. Failure to submit the certificates at time of bid may result in rejection of the Bid. Prequalification is required irrespective of the contract amount. Central Florida Expressway Authority, in accordance with the Provisions of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, as amended, 42 U.S.C. 2000e et seq., the Florida Civil Rights Act of 1992, as amended, 760.10 et seq., Fla. Stat. (1996), and other federal and state discrimination statutes, prohibits discrimination on the basis of race, color, sex, age, national origin, religion, and disability or handicap. CFX notifies all Bidders and individuals it requires and encourages equal employment opportunity for minority and women as employees and subcontractors. CFX notifies all Bidders it encourages small, minority and women owned businesses to have full opportunity to submit Bids in response to this invitation and Bidders will not be discriminated against on the basis of sex, race, color, national origin, religion or disability, or other protected status. CFX will require efforts be made to encourage participation of local minority and women business enterprises on contracts considered for an award. Bidders requiring assistance or information with regard to DBE/MBE/WBE certification and utilization may contact the CFX Supplier Diversity Department at (407) 690-5000. The D/M/WBE participation objective for this project is fifteen percent (15%). Only D/M/WBEs certified by one or more of the following agencies at the time the Bid is submitted may be counted toward the objective: Orange County, Florida; the City of Orlando, Florida; Florida Department of Transportation. Firms certified by the Florida Department of Transportation as a Disadvantaged Business Enterprise (DBE) will be accepted. From the first date of publication of this invitation, no person may contact any CFX Board Member, Officer or Employee with respect to this invitation or the services to be provided. Reference is made to the lobbying guidelines of CFX for further information regarding this Non-Solicitation Provision. All work shall be done in accordance with the Bidding Documents of the Central Florida Expressway Authority. It is CFX's intent to award the project to the lowest responsive and responsible Bidder. CFX specifically reserves the right to take a Bidder's past performance with the CFX (and others) into consideration in determining whether the Bidder and Bid are responsive, responsible and qualified and most advantageous to CFX. By submitting its Bid, the Bidder is signifying its awareness and understanding that the Bid process will be subject in all respects to the provisions of applicable laws, rules and regulations and the policies of CFX (as they may be amended or modified from time to time). Pursuant to Florida Statutes, Section 119.07(1), upon the earlier to occur of (i) CFX's Notice of Award of the contract, or (ii) thirty days after Bid opening, all Bids submitted pursuant to this Invitation to Bid (including all components thereof and all other materials submitted in connection therewith) shall become public records. Thereafter (with very limited exceptions) all Bids, proposals, documents, letters, software and other materials submitted to CFX by on behalf of any Bidder (including material that a Bidder may consider confidential or proprietary) may be inspected, examined and copied by any person desiring to do so in accordance with Florida Statutes, Chapter 119. It is not necessary for any person to obtain the consent of CFX, or the Bidder, to exercise its right under Chapter 119. Any person who is adversely affected by: (i) bid specifications, (ii) a notice of an intent to award or CFX action making the selection at a public meeting of the CFX Board, or (iii) an outcome of PreAward meeting and who wants to protest the requirements, specifications, project plans or other materials, the intent to award decision, an outcome of a Pre-Award meeting, or selection decision must comply with the proper procedures in the Central Florida Expressway Authority's Policy for Resolution of Protests, Policy: PROC 3.1, which is available for review upon request at the CFX Office, 4974 ORL Tower Road, Orlando, Florida. Failure to comply with Policy: PROC 3.1 shall constitute a waiver of any protest proceedings. A protest bond in the amount of $5,000.00 will be required to protest the Bid package or Bid solicitation. A protest bond in the amount of $5,000.00, or 1% of the lowest bid submitted, whichever is greater, will be required to protest a Notice of Intent to Award, or the CFX Board's selection determination. No protest bond is required to protest an outcome of a Pre-Award meeting All Bids shall remain open for acceptance by CFX for ninety (90) calendar days after the day of the Bid opening. The right is reserved by CFX to reject any or all Bids.
